India's cricket team has made a bold move by selecting a 15-year-old sensation, Vaibhav Sooryavanshi, for their T20 squad, a decision that has been hailed as 'thoroughly deserved' by many. But what makes this move particularly fascinating is the accompanying change in leadership. The selectors have decided to drop Suryakumar Yadav as captain, just three months after he led the team to World Cup glory. This raises a deeper question: is it ever a good idea to make such rapid changes in leadership, especially in a high-pressure sport like cricket?

From my perspective, the decision to replace Suryakumar Yadav as captain is a strategic one. While his performance at the World Cup and in the IPL was underwhelming, it is important to remember that he was a key player in the team's success. What many people don't realize is that the pressure of leading a team to victory can be immense, and it is not uncommon for players to struggle after such a significant achievement. This is why I think the selectors have made a wise decision by giving Shreyas Iyer the reins. Iyer, who has a more consistent record in T20 cricket, is a more experienced and stable choice for the role.

One thing that immediately stands out is the potential impact of Sooryavanshi's selection. The 15-year-old sensation has already made a name for himself in the IPL, where he topped the batting charts with 776 runs, including one hundred and five half-centuries. If he can maintain this form at the international level, he could become India's youngest-ever debutant, beating the record set by Sachin Tendulkar.
